Dover man killed, search turns up assault weapons

Police say a Dover man was killed outside his home and a subsequent search of the property turned up two assault-style guns among other weapons and drugs.

Dover Police identified the dead man as 29-year-old Walter Pereira, saying he was shot outside the home early Thursday morning.

Police were alerted to the shooting at 3:42 a.m. on Forest Creek Drive. Upon arrival, officers and paramedics found Pereira lying on the ground with gunshot wounds. He was later pronounced dead at the hospital.

A search of the home turned up an AK47 rifle, AR-15 rifle, 12-gauge shotgun, Smith and Wesson 9mm handgun, KBI Inc handgun, Springfield Armory 9mm handgun, Freedom Arms .22 Caliber handgun, 2,130.4 grams of marijuana, 914 doses of M/30 oxycodone pills, 27 grams of methamphetamine, 6.38 grams of cocaine, 30 doses of LSD, $7,186, and several pieces of drug paraphernalia.

Rayvaughn Jones, 29, who lived with Pereira, was arrested without incident and faces 13 charges.
